I read the original post a few times last night so I remember the content.

Short version: The work order was to install Z1 front UCA, align, and OP explicitly stated to set camber to avoid rubbing. Alignment shop only aligned it back to within OEM tolerance (the shop set front at -0.8 degrees up front). OP took delivery and noticed rubbing, front fender got a bit of paint rubbed off around the fender lip/edge area. OP contacted AAM and received no resolve. OP ended up taking car to another shop and set camber at -1.8.
